Temperature Level and Paint Application
When it pertains to industrial paint, temperature level plays a critical duty in how well the paint sticks and dries out. If you're intending a project, watch on the temperature level variety recommended by the paint producer. Preferably, you wish to work within that array for optimum results.
When temperature levels are also low, paint can end up being thick and more difficult to apply, bring about uneven coverage. You might find yourself dealing with brush strokes or roller marks that simply will not disappear.
On the other side, high temperatures can trigger paint to dry as well promptly. This can lead to problems like breaking or peeling off, as the paint doesn't have enough time to bond properly to the surface.
If it's too warm, take into consideration arranging your work for cooler parts of the day, such as early morning or late afternoon.

Wind and Outdoor Conditions
While you mightn't think about wind as a major factor, it can substantially influence the result of outside business paint projects. High winds can disrupt your application process, causing paint to completely dry as well promptly. When repaint dries also quick, it can cause an unequal finish or visible brush strokes.
You'll additionally deal with obstacles with paint overspray, as wind can bring fragments away from the desired surface, causing lost materials and potential damage to surrounding areas.
Moreover, strong gusts can produce safety hazards on duty site. Ladders and scaffolding are extra prone to tipping in windy problems, putting your crew in jeopardy.
